grand

 
/grænd/ adj (IMPORTANT)

Definition

important and large in degree or size: When I mess up, I mess up on a grand scale. The ten top essayists will compete for the $10,000 grand prize (= the largest prize in the competition). The new restaurant will hold its grand opening Saturday (= a big celebration of the opening of its business).
